"Lenora? Lenora, where are you?" Rushed footsteps echo through the otherwise empty house. The books previously resting on the coffee table lie scattered on the floor but Devyn moves past them without a second glance. "Nora?"

A giggle follows Devyn's voice. The woman smiles softly and slows her movements. "Hm, I wonder where she could be?" She says in a purposely loud voice. Another soft laugh sounds through the air and Devyn follows the noise into the next room.

"Well, I don't see her in here," Quietly, Devyn moves through her husband's office and towards the bookshelf. She silently crouches down to the closed cabinet and grasps onto the handles.

With a gasp, she pulls the doors open to reveal the small child hiding inside. "There you are!" She smiles widely when the face of her grinning daughter greets her. Her long, light brown hair frames her face, her cheeks tinted red from holding back laughter. "You sneaky little money."

"But you still found me, mommy," Climbing out of the cabinet, Lenora stands and clumsily wipes a strand of hair from her bright brown eyes.

"I did, didn't I?"

"You're smart," Lenora tells her confidently. "Like daddy."

"Ooh, not many people are smart like daddy is," Devyn shakes her hand and grabs onto her daughter's hands. "And speaking of, I saw you knocked his books onto the floor."

"I-I was going to pick them up," Lenora stumbles slightly over her words, once again moving her hair out of her eyes. "But I had to hide."

"That's okay, we can go do it now. Dad should be home soon," Leading her daughter out of the office, Devyn takes her into the living room and together they pick the books off the floor before stacking them back onto the coffee table. "Now, you want to help me with dinner?"

"Yes!" Jumping up with joy, Lenora rushes into the kitchen, leaving a smiling Devyn to catch up with her.

Removing all the needed ingredients, Devyn mixes everything together with her daughter's help and has dinner in the oven when the front door opens. "I'm home!" Spencer calls out from the living room. He removes his bag from his shoulder and rests it on the couch before joining his wife and daughter in the kitchen. "Wow, that smells great." He says while greeting Devyn with a kiss before running a hand over Lenora's hair.

"You're daughter did most of the work,"

"Is that right?" Spencer asks, turning to Lenora in time to see her nodding proudly. "I take it you two had a good day?"

"Amazing. How was class?"

"The usual," Spencer shrugs. "Half the students were late, the other half were asleep."

"I'm sure not all of them were," Devyn chuckles. "Don't take it personally, hun. They're just exhausted from other classes and I'm sure working minimum wage jobs."

"Yeah," Spencer sighs. "They're all mostly passing, so." Spencer gives another shrug before looking to Lenora who listens to them patiently. "How was school, darling?"

"Lucy got a haircut," The young child informs her parents who both share a look. "And Jeremy said his mommy has a baby in her belly. He's going to have a baby brother soon." With a thoughtful look, Lenora looks to Devyn. "Mommy, do you have a baby in your belly?"

"No, sweetie, I don't," Devyn shakes her head softly. Spencer looks between her and Lenora.

"Do you want a baby brother or sister?" He asks his daughter and the girl nods without hesitation. "Well, I mean, the princess wants it..." Spencer trails off and turns to Devyn, wrapping his arms around her waist.

"Are you telling me you want another kid?"

"You don't?"

Looking over her husband's shoulder, Devyn watches her daughter carefully coloring in her coloring book. "Honestly? I'd be happy with more than just one more."

"Oh, okay," Spencer grins and leans forward to connect his lips with Devyn's. "In that case..."

"Alright," Chuckling, Devyn gently pushes Spencer away from her to check the food. "We'll talk about this later. Richard's almost here."

"Grandpa?" Devyn covers her mouth to silence her loud laugh and Spencer shakes his head. It had been a joke at first, telling Lenora that's who Richard was. But she's refused to call him anything else since.

"Yes, dear, grandpa," Spencer nods to his daughter while his wife tries to contain her giggles. "You know, I don't think he minds it, actually."

"Of course not, he loves it," Devyn nods in agreement. "He'll just never admit it."

Moments later, Richard enters the house and Lenora is out of her chair in seconds, rushing to meet him. "Grandpa!" She shouts in glee and jumps into the man's arms. He groans playfully but he holds her up with his arms wrapped around her.

"Hey, bug," Richard greets the enthusiastic child equally so. "Growing like a weed, I see." Setting her down, Richard ruffles Lenora's hair before moving to hug Devyn.

"Mommy measured me! I grew an inch!"

"Wow, really?"

"Yup," Lenora nods. "Can I show him, mommy?"

"Of course," Devyn nods and nudges Lenora in the direction of her room. The door frame serves as their measuring board, Devyn and Spencer mark it every time Lenora grows an obvious height. The little girl loves it.

"She'll be a great big sister," Spencer rests his chin on Devyn's shoulder, his arms around her waist. His words are whispered into her ear and Devyn smiles.

"Yeah, she would be," She whispers back to him. "But to a boy or a girl?"

"Why not both?"

Laughing, Devyn turns in Spencer's arm and cups his cheeks. "Both it is."
